Entry Requirements

  • Age 16+ with a genuine interest in hospitality, hotel, luxury service or tourism careers
  • GCSE-equivalent secondary education (or overseas equivalent)
  • Basic English proficiency for online learning (IELTS 5.0 or equivalent for international applicants)
  • Access to a computer with reliable internet for online delivery
  • No prior hospitality qualification required — this is a foundation route

The Certificate in Hotel Quality Awareness runs for approximately 3 to 6 months. That timeframe covers the taught modules, applied coursework and the final assessment for the Certificate in Hotel Quality Awareness.

You can study the Certificate in Hotel Quality Awareness either fully online or on-campus in central London. Online students receive the same taught content and assessment schedule as on-campus learners, so your Certificate in Hotel Quality Awareness outcome is the same in either mode.

The Certificate in Hotel Quality Awareness is designed against UK and international hospitality benchmarks, including Institute of Travel and Tourism (ITT) and Association of British Travel Agents (ABTA) guidance. The Certificate in Hotel Quality Awareness sits inside LSILHHM's aligned-with (not accredited-by) professional-body framework.
